For the Iranian people, the "tutors" are seen as a parasitic class that has prioritised regional adventurism over domestic stability. Decades of funneling national wealth into foreign proxies like Hezbollah and Hamas have left the Iranian infrastructure in tatters. The slogan "Neither Gaza nor Lebanon, my life for Iran" has transformed from a protest chant into a national doctrine, reflecting a deep-seated anger that Iranian oil money builds schools in Beirut while children in Sistan and Baluchestan suffer in crumbling classrooms.
